I was pleasantly surprised by Freesourcing. I half expected it to be either full of magical thinking nonsense or totally impractical, but it turned out to be energetic, concise, and to the point about starting up a company or several companies with minimal or no resources other than your own time and dedication.
It's not going to turn you into an entrepreneurial genius overnight, but it does lay out all the basic things you need to know and gives you a good 'shape' for your attitude towards getting things done. So if you think of it as a very well written and enjoyable start point you will be on the right track.

Jonathan Yates has compiled a huge list of tips and pointers for how to start your business for next to nothing. Obviously not everything is included here and the practicalities of some of his suggestions will most likely vary wildly.
Where this book works best is as inspiration, suddenly everything seems much more doable. For evey doubt you have about you potential business Yates has the freesourcing solution. A perfect gift for that person in your life who is always dreaming of starting their own business but lets their doubts and fears get in the way.

This book is all about how to set up your prospective business without money. Listing ways to get help and resources for free.
It is divided into 7 chapters: Use What Your Have; Setting Up The Foundations of Your Business; IT and Communication; Help, Skills and Training; Research, Innovation and Prototypes; Customers, Brands, Marketing and Sales; Growth and the Next Steps. All full of useful tips and of great value to someone trying to start their own business.
